CodeMate

No results

Help CenterAnalytics and ReportingInterpreting Conversation Metrics

Interpreting Conversation Metrics

Last updated April 20, 2024

Introduction: Conversation metrics provide valuable insights into the performance, engagement, and effectiveness of your chatbot interactions. By analyzing conversation metrics, you can understand user behavior, identify trends, and make data-driven decisions to optimize your chatbot's performance and user experience. In this guide, we'll explore how to interpret conversation metrics in CodeMate to gain actionable insights and improve the effectiveness of your chatbot.

Step-by-Step Guide:

  1. Access Conversation Metrics:
  • Log in to your CodeMate account and navigate to the analytics or reporting section.
  • Access conversation metrics such as message volume, user engagement, conversation success rates, and more.
  1. Understand Key Metrics:
  • Familiarize yourself with the key conversation metrics provided by CodeMate and their definitions.
  • Examples of key metrics include:
  • Message Volume: The total number of messages exchanged between users and the chatbot over a specific period.
  • User Engagement: The level of user interaction and participation in chatbot conversations, measured by metrics such as message frequency and session duration.
  • Conversation Success Rate: The percentage of conversations that achieve the intended outcome or goal, such as completing a transaction or resolving a user query.
  1. Identify Trends and Patterns:
  • Analyze conversation metrics over time to identify trends, patterns, and fluctuations in user behavior.
  • Look for correlations between metrics, such as changes in message volume affecting user engagement or conversational success rates.
  1. Segment Data for Analysis:
  • Segment conversation metrics data based on different criteria such as time periods, user demographics, conversation types, or chatbot features.
  • Compare metrics across segments to identify differences and insights that may inform optimization strategies.
  1. Evaluate Performance Against Goals:
  • Evaluate conversation metrics against predefined goals and benchmarks to assess chatbot performance and effectiveness.
  • Determine whether conversation metrics align with desired outcomes and objectives, and identify areas for improvement or optimization.
  1. Identify Opportunities for Improvement:
  • Use conversation metrics to identify opportunities for improving chatbot performance and user experience.
  • Look for areas with low engagement, high drop-off rates, or low conversation success rates, and develop strategies to address these issues.
  1. Optimize Chatbot Strategy and Design:
  • Use insights from conversation metrics to inform chatbot strategy and design decisions.
  • Adjust conversation flows, messaging, user prompts, and bot behavior based on data-driven insights to enhance user engagement and achieve better outcomes.
  1. Monitor Changes and Iterate:
  • Continuously monitor conversation metrics over time to track the impact of optimizations and changes.
  • Iterate on chatbot design, features, and strategies based on ongoing analysis of conversation metrics to drive continuous improvement.

Conclusion: Interpreting conversation metrics in CodeMate provides valuable insights into user behavior, engagement, and chatbot performance. By analyzing conversation metrics, identifying trends, and making data-driven decisions, you can optimize your chatbot to deliver more effective and engaging conversational experiences for your users.

Was this article helpful?